Laying a Solid Financial Foundation: Essential Money Management Tips
Managing your finances effectively is crucial for reaching financial well-being. It empowers you to execute informed decisions about your expenditures, accumulation for the future, and realize your fiscal goals.
Here are some essential tips to help you build a solid financial foundation:
* Create a comprehensive budget that monitors your income and expenses.
* Prioritize saving by setting aside a share of your income regularly.
* Minimize unnecessary spending.
* Investigate different investment options to increase your wealth over time.
By implementing these tips, you can fortify your financial position and establish yourself up for long-term prosperity.
Understanding Personal Finance: From Budgeting to Investing
Personal finance can seem daunting, packed with complex terms and strategies. But demystifying it is achievable through a systematic approach that starts with the basics of budgeting. A well-crafted budget enables you to observe your income and expenses, offering valuable insight into your capital health. Equipped this understanding, you can develop informed decisions about saving and investing.
Investing presents the potential for long-term growth, but it's crucial to tackle it strategically. Researching different as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, and real estate, can help you build a diversified portfolio that matches your risk tolerance and financial goals. Remember, investing is a marathon, not a sprint; patience and a long-term perspective are key to success.
